Web2 de ago. de 2024 · Both nirmatrelvir and ritonavir can be excreted into your saliva, putting them back in your mouth where you can taste them. This could be why the bad taste of Paxlovid lasts until the next dose. In addition to the bad taste, Paxlovid also has other side effects, including diarrhea, elevated blood pressure, and muscle aches. 2. Web19 de out. de 2024 · Patients with mild renal impairment or normal renal function should receive the standard dose of 300 mg nirmatrelvir (that’s two 150 mg tablets) and 100 mg ritonavir (or one 100 mg tablet). Web6 de jun. de 2024 · Paxlovid should start working very quickly, though it may take a few doses for the drug to reach its key concentration in the body. If you miss a dose of Paxlovid within eight hours of the time it’s normally taken, you should take that dose as soon as possible and return to your normal dosing schedule, per the FDA.
